Livelihood and Skills Development
The Livelihood and Skills Development Program at Second Chance Foundation International is dedicated to breaking the cycle of poverty by empowering individuals with practical, marketable skills. Understanding that sustainable change begins with economic independence, the program offers comprehensive training across a range of trades such as tailoring, carpentry, information technology, and agriculture. Each participant is encouraged to discover and nurture their unique talents, laying the foundation for a self-sufficient future.
Beyond technical skills, the program emphasizes essential business development knowledge and financial literacy. Participants are taught how to manage income, create business plans, and navigate the challenges of entrepreneurship. Access to startup kits or revolving capital enables them to put their training into action, launching small enterprises that generate stable incomes. This holistic approach ensures that participants are not only skilled but also equipped to sustain and grow their ventures over time.
Community and collaboration are at the heart of this initiative. Through mentorship programs and peer support groups, individuals are provided with ongoing encouragement, accountability, and opportunities to share best practices. These networks build confidence, resilience, and leadership within participants, allowing them to not only transform their own lives but also inspire and uplift others in their communities. By fostering economic empowerment, the Livelihood and Skills Development Program ignites lasting change at both the personal and community levels.
